What to Consider About Assisted Living in Jurupa Valley

Recently established in 2011, Jurupa Valley is located in Riverside County, California, and is home to a little more than 100,000 residents, 9.6 percent of whom are over the age of 65. In California, assisted living facilities are officially known as Residential Care Facilities (RCFs), and while there is only one RCF located in Jurupa Valley itself, an additional 56 RCFs are located in surrounding cities such as Riverside, Eastvale and Ontario.

Benefits and Drawbacks of Assisted Living in Jurupa Valley

  • Seniors can easily and safely travel throughout Jurupa Valley with the help of Metrolink Trains and Riverside Transit Agency, both of which are affordable public transportation options that offer reduced fares for seniors. 

  • The Jurupa Valley area is home to world-class medical facilities, including Pacific Grove Hospital, in case of medical emergencies or illness. 

  • Jurupa Valley has a comfortable climate with limited precipitation and warm winters, which makes it an attractive option for seniors who enjoy the outdoors. The city has an average low temperature in January of 42 degrees Fahrenheit, which is considerably warmer than the U.S. average of 22.6 degrees.

  • Although the overall cost of living in Jurupa Valley is 53 percent higher than the national average, seniors living in the area may find themselves saving money on expenses such as healthcare, which is 16 percent lower than the national average.

  • Riverside County has an array of community resources for seniors, including Senior Advantage, which gives seniors the opportunity to participate in recreational events and classes in the area, as well as three senior centers. 

  • Crime rates in the Jurupa Valley and Riverside County are a bit higher than the rest of the state, meaning that seniors living in the area may feel unsafe. Jurupa Valley's residents have a 1 in 187 chance of becoming the victim of a violent crime and a 1 in 28 chance of becoming the victim of property crimes. By comparison, the average California resident has a 1 in 229 chance of becoming the victim of a violent crime and a 1 in 39 chance of becoming a property crime victim.

Financial Assistance for Assisted Living in Jurupa Valley

Seniors in the Jurupa Valley area can apply for assistance under a 1915(c) Medicaid Assisted Living Waiver, which helps seniors pay for the cost of services provided in RCFs. 

Seniors in California who are receiving Supplemental Security Income (SSI) can apply for an Optional State Supplement to help with room and board expenses, which are capped by the state for SSI recipients.

Family supplementation is not allowed in California.
